In the 1980s, Cesare Paciotti, along with his sister Paola, took over the artisan shoe workshop opened by his parents in 1948, making it a symbol of footwear, earning the nickname "the shoe king."
From the Marche region to Hollywood and Asia: shoes made in the Macerata district are worn by big names in film and an international clientele.
A highly distinctive brand for its collections, global success, and rebirth, always with Civitanova Marche as its hub.
From advertising campaigns to modeling, Cesare Paciotti shoes, with their distinctive style, somewhere between glamour and rock, have marked the history of Made in Marche fashion, achieving success across the globe. Refined, high-quality materials and precise, recognizable details create a concept of luxury that has stood the test of time.

Codes that Casare was encouraged to hone from a very young age within his family.
What was his focus?
He focused on quality leathers, craftsmanship, and the iconic dagger as his logo.
That dagger would become his emblem, and the shoes would also become a jewel, with a dedicated collection.
